// Broker upgrade notes for plugin authors:
// Quillbus 4.x replaces the legacy 3.x wire protocol. Plugins must
// construct the client with explicit protocol negotiation enabled,
// or connections to the Larkfield cluster will be silently downgraded
// and dropped after 30s. Topic names are unchanged. For local testing
// against the sandbox broker, authenticate with the key below.

API key for bafof-bagaf: qvz2-qi

## Changelog — Font vendoring defaults changed

As of this release, the Bracken UI build no longer fetches third-party fonts at build time. All typefaces used by the Lanternwell suite are now vendored into the repo under a dedicated assets directory, and the fetch step is skipped by default. If you're onboarding, nothing to install — the fonts travel with the checkout. The build flags controlling this behavior are listed below.

settings of hadup-yafog:
LAMAEL_PIN=3761
LAMAEL_TENANT=istmir
LAMAEL_METRICS_HOST=metrics.lamael.plorvasys.test
LAMAEL_SEAL=seal_8ea68500
LAMAEL_STANDBY_TEAM=fraok

**Key ceremony checklist — item 7 (Plumefeather metrics sidecar)**

Confirm the signing key for the Plumefeather aggregation sidecar has been sealed into the offline vault, witnessed by two reviewers. Verify the vault's tamper seal number in the ceremony log. Before sealing, the custodian must read back the recovery passphrase, recorded immediately below.

unlock words, bahop-fawef: novmir-druwyn-soriel-rusdor-kasion

### Dependency Pinning Policy Endpoint

The Cobblestone policy service enforces our pinning rules: exact versions in production manifests, ranges allowed only in dev. Query `/policy/pins` before cutting a release to see any violations blocking the train. Responses are cached for five minutes. The endpoint requires service auth, using the key below.

API key for yahig-tadup: kto7_ubizbYm